Sporting News Report

Return man Michael Lewis is back in Pro Bowl form after a subpar 2003. In three games, he is averaging 11.3 yards on punt returns and 24.9 on kickoffs. His presence has forced opponents to sacrifice field position by pooching kickoffs or hanging punts high and short.

The healthy return of DL Darren Howard and Brian Young gives the Saints one of the league's deepest line rotations. DEs Howard, Charles Grant and Will Smith could start for most teams, and Young and Johnathan Sullivan are solid inside, where many players can contribute, though none is dominant.


YOUTH MOVEMENT: The team's 2003 second-round pick, OT Jon Stinchcomb, is smart and has improved at the point of attack. But he has been inactive in the first three games. Scouts think he might be a 'tweener--not athletic enough to play tackle, not powerful enough for guard. The club can't afford to waste second-round picks on players who can't contribute on game day.
